The Sound
The gentle ambiance of a European street café, juxtaposed with the soothing sounds of a canal, provides the perfect backdrop for a genre that has been quietly resonating with audiences: cozy café jazz. The sonic landscape here is characterized by soft piano melodies, delicate brush strokes on drums, and subtle nuances of double bass. The production often employs a warm, analog feel, reminiscent of a bygone era, inviting listeners to lose themselves in the tranquility of their surroundings. The gentle interplay of instruments creates an intimate atmosphere, making it ideal for studying, working, or simply enjoying a peaceful moment.
What makes this track work is its ability to foster a sense of connection and calm, as if one is sitting in a sun-drenched café, watching the world go by. The sound palette typically includes light, airy piano chords blended with soft, jazzy guitar riffs, and occasionally, the faint hum of ambient street sounds in the background, which adds a layer of authenticity. Deep Dive
Delving deeper into the arrangement and production techniques, the essence of café jazz lies in its simplicity and elegance. The songwriting often features repetitive, cyclical chord progressions that evoke a sense of familiarity. This familiarity allows listeners to zone in on their tasks without being distracted by complex melodies or lyrics. The genius of this arrangement is how it balances structure and freedom—while the chords remain consistent, improvisational solos from instruments like the saxophone or trumpet occasionally emerge, adding a dynamic element without overwhelming the listener.
Production techniques play a pivotal role in crafting this sound. Many creators utilize a combination of digital audio workstations (DAWs) and virtual instruments to replicate the rich tone of live recordings. Layering is key; by subtly stacking multiple takes of the same instrument, producers can create a fuller sound that feels organic. Additionally, the use of effects like reverb and delay helps to create space, simulating the acoustics of a café environment where sound bounces and blends seamlessly with other elements.
Vocal performances, if included, are often minimalistic—soft, breathy tones that add to the ambiance without drawing too much attention. This restraint in vocal delivery mirrors the overall ethos of the genre, which is not about showcasing virtuosity but rather about creating a mood that resonates with the listener. The tracks are often devoid of harsh dynamics, making them perfect for background ambiance, allowing the listener to focus on their work or study while still enjoying a rich sonic experience.
Industry Context
The rise of cozy café jazz aligns with broader trends in streaming music consumption. As per recent reports, playlists featuring lo-fi and chill music have seen substantial growth, with millions of streams on platforms like Spotify and YouTube. These playlists often serve as the go-to soundtracks for students and professionals looking for unobtrusive yet engaging music. The success of these genres reflects a growing demand for music that complements a busy lifestyle, aligning perfectly with the needs of today’s multitasking audience.
From a label strategy standpoint, independent artists are increasingly embracing this genre, bypassing traditional routes to reach their audience directly through platforms like Bandcamp and SoundCloud. This democratization of music distribution allows creators to cultivate niche communities without the constraints often associated with major labels. The cozy café jazz phenomenon illustrates how independent artists can thrive by tapping into specific aesthetic trends that resonate with listeners seeking solace in their daily routines.
Cultural Impact
Café jazz music is part of a larger cultural movement that embraces relaxation and productivity. This genre has found a home within various online communities, particularly those focused on study and work habits. The aesthetic appeal of cozy cafés, combined with serene jazz music, creates an inviting atmosphere that is both comforting and conducive to concentration. As a result, fan communities often share their favorite playlists, further promoting this genre across social media platforms.
Platforms like TikTok have also played a significant role in the virality of café jazz. Short clips of relaxing café settings paired with soft jazz tunes have become popular, leading to a resurgence in interest for both the genre and the aesthetic it represents. This trend showcases how visual storytelling can enhance the auditory experience, creating a holistic ambiance that captivates viewers and listeners alike.
